MOHAMED SHINAN ACADEMIC PORTFOLIO COMMUNITY CENTRE TRIPLE POD Community-Centric Space: In addition to addressing housing needs, our proposal emphasizes the importance of communal spaces in enhancing community cohesion and quality of life. The triple pod configuration serves as a dedicated community center, offering a multifunctional space for recreation, socialization, and skill-building activities. Combining elements such as a library, cafeteria, DIY workshop, and open event space, this communal hub serves as the heart of the neighborhood, fostering connections and empowering residents to engage in mean- ingful activities. IDEA & CONCEPT The current Kingsland Shop- ping Centre site poorly inte- grates with its surroundings, limiting movement across the Town Centre. Redevelopment offers the opportunity to create new routes and public spaces, enhancing connec- tions between Dalston’s character areas while improv- ing pedestrian experiences and east-west links between Dalston Lane and Kingsland High Street. The project can deliver new housing, including afford- able units, while preserving Dalston’s architectural charac- ter. Active ground-floor uses are encouraged to enliven streets, and mixed-use spaces should prioritize retail and commercial activities. Addi- tionally, the redevelopment can expand Dalston’s creative and cultural hub around Ash- win Street. 11 / 16
